Anniversary edition of APEX already sold out

International aerial work platform exhibition in MECC Maastricht

Six months before the start of the tenth edition of APEX, the international trade fair in the field of mobile work platforms is already completely sold out. Over 10% more booth space has been sold for the 2020 edition than the 2017 show.

APEX will celebrate its 10th edition in 2020 with a return to Maastricht, the city where the exhibition was held for the first time in 1996.

In particular, the return to the MECC in Maastricht - after two editions at the RAI in Amsterdam - has resulted in a significant enlargement of the outdoor area. Here in June, more exhibitors will present themselves on larger stands than before.

From June 9 to 11, more than 103 exhibitors both inside and outside the MECC will present all kinds of aerial work platforms, telehandlers, work elevators, scissor elevators, vertical work platforms and other high-quality scaffolding equipment.

In addition to the presence of virtually all the top manufacturers from Europe and the U.S., the growing influence of Chinese suppliers is also abundantly clear, with more than 15 exhibitors.

Also notable this year is the number of exhibitors specializing in battery technology as a result of the increased interest in non-diesel power sources in the field of mobile aerial work platforms.

APEX 2020 is organized by BV I.P.I. of Goor and the KHL Group of England. The B2B exhibition is sponsored by the well-known trade magazine Access International Magazine and supported by the International Powered Access Federation (IPAF).

Tony Kenter, Managing Director of BV I.P.I.: "We are delighted that APEX sold out well in advance, especially since we had more exhibition space available this year. Proven to be a valued meeting place for the global aerial platform industry, we are delighted that in addition to platform manufacturers, exhibitors include component suppliers and software specialists."

Simultaneously with APEX, the annual congress of the European Rental Association as well as the International Rental Exhibition (IRE) will once again be held at the MECC. This means that managers of all major rental companies from Europe will be present in Maastricht.
